19. Scrambled eggs fried in bacon grease!
Then, keep some of the grease back, re-heat it in the pan, add a slurry of flour and milk to make cream gravy to pour over biscuits!! MMMmmmmmMMMmmmm! I love Southern breakfasts!!!!!

25. You need a shallow pan...
deep pans keep in the moisture and the bacon tends to "boil" more than fry.

Set on medium or medium low and leave it while you do your chores. Once it browns, flip it, and forget it again for a while.
